Singer-Actress Jennifer Lopez and her husband Marc Anthony are suing a British company for $5 million for allegedly using the couple's image to promote their range, according to reports.
The pair filed a trademark infringement lawsuit in a Los Angeles district court on Wednesday (Feb. 25), claiming executives at Silver Cross had used a snap of them with their one year old twins, Max and Emme, in their strollers without prior permission.
The suit accuses the British manufacturer of using the photograph of the famous family online and in advertisements, thereby deceiving the public into "believing that Lopez and Anthony endorse and sponsor" the brand.
Lopez and Anthony are seeking at least $5 million in damages, a permanent injunction against any further use of their names or images in the company's advertising, and any money that may have been made by allegedly using the couple as unwitting spokesmodels.
